PSG vs. Manchester United: Lineups, Stats, and Match Preview
Paris Saint-Germain coach Luis Enrique has lauded the "quality" and "mentality" of his academy prospects as the team prepares for a second pre-season friendly against Manchester United in Gothenburg. Many senior players are still unavailable for PSG.
Following a 3-0 loss to Mallorca, Enrique acknowledged the team's performance was "interesting" in the first half. He stated, "It's difficult to make a fair assessment. It's not the result we would have liked, but that's football. When you play against Paris Saint-Germain, it's a source of motivation for every team. That's only natural. It's our first week of pre-season… it's to be expected. We're waiting for our international players to return before we can really see what our team looks like."
In their recent match, Michael Carrick's Manchester United side secured a 2-1 victory over Atletico de Madrid, with Bryan Mbeumo scoring both goals. Carrick, who has guided his team back to the Champions League, highlighted the squad's "spirit and camaraderie" as positive signs during pre-season.
"It is such a great group to work with in terms of the spirit to work with each other, [to let] us help them and guide them," Carrick told MUTV. "We had six-and-a-half weeks away from the players, so it's a long time compared to what I am used to. We are enjoying work and I am looking forward to the season. It's great to see the boys getting on so naturally and enjoying each other's company."
Man United vs. PSG Team News
Manchester United's new midfielder Youri Tielemans may feature for the first time since his £35 million move from Aston Villa. Captain Bruno Fernandes could also return after a hamstring injury, though Senne Lammens and Matheus Cunha are unwell.
For PSG, French playmaker Maghnes Akliouche will not be available as he recently joined from Monaco for £42.8 million. The club is still missing many of its World Cup 2026 participants, but Marquinhos, Nuno Mendes, Vitinha, and Joao Neves might be available for the fixture. According to L'Equipe, young players Adam Ayari, Paul Bourdin, Younes Idder, and Axel Koukaba have been involved in training.
